London: November 1905. England and the world are changing. Into the rooms of Sherlock Holmes come Nikola Tesla and Thomas Edison - with new inventions that will alter the course of human history - only both inventions have gone missing.

Can Holmes, Watson, and Irene Adler somehow unravel the latest diabolical scheme of Marie Chartier - evil daughter of the late Professor Moriarty? Can world peace be achieved by the most powerful weapon ever created? Can death itself be overcome by a scientific genius? And can Sherlock Holmes survive the greatest personal loss of his career?

And, sadly, this is the last book in this series, and it was fantastic! It alludes to the usual complains about having the great detective in love; brings, as usual, very-well known names into the story (mainly, Tesla and Edison, and boy! did I enjoyed THAT rivalry :P ) and, in short, it was a fantastic end to the series.

If that wasn't enough, we get to see Holmes and Watson's friendship at their best, and enjoy a smart, devious Watson :P

Seriously, if you love Sherlock Holmes and want to have a laugh, this series is a must read :D

Oh, and I think I forgot to say this before, but Christopher Power's narration is delightful ♥
